I'm unable to log in to Steam for some reason. The error message says "Something went wrong while attempting to sign you in" but that does not tell me much. What is "Something"? Where do I even begin?

"Something went wrong while trying to sign you in" Steam error messages show up every time a user tries to log into their account through Windows. These types of errors are really irritating because one will be locked out from the library of different games that are accommodated on Steam, updates, and community features. A lot of people have encountered this message while trying to log in, without being shown what causes this problem, hence being unable to advance.

The "Something went wrong while trying to sign you in" error can be attributed to several factors. These include some of the most common reasons: network connectivity problems where Steam cannot connect to its servers due to a weak and unstable internet connection. Another probable reason would be temporary outages or maintenance sessions of Steam.

Sometimes, corrupted application data or caches are the reason for not being able to log in successfully. Added to this, several third-party products like antivirus programs or firewalls will conflict with your tries and block Steam's connection.

Even though this "Something went wrong while attempting to log you in" error can hamper Steam's provided services, there are a few probable ways that may restore functionality: a stable internet connection, a clean cache of Steam, or adjusting some settings via a Firewall program.

Fix 1. Check internet connection

A weak or unstable internet connection is one of the most common reasons for the "Something went wrong while attempting to sign you in" error.

  • Type Troubleshoot in Windows search and press Enter.
  • Select Other troubleshooters.
  • Find Network & Internet troubleshooter from the list and select Run.
  • Wait till the process is finished and apply the offered fixes.
  • Restart your computer.

Fix 2. Restart Steam

A simple restart of Steam may resolve temporary issues that are causing login problems.

  • Close the Steam client completely by clicking Exit in the Steam menu.
  • Press Ctrl + Shift + Esc to open Task Manager and ensure no Steam processes are running.
  • Relaunch Steam and attempt to log in or start the game again.

Fix 3. Check Steam server status

Sometimes, the issue is on Steam's end, such as during server maintenance or outages.

  • Visit the official website that monitors the Steam server status.
  • If there’s an ongoing outage, wait for Steam to resolve the issue.

Fix 4. Clear Steam caches

Corrupted cache files can interfere with Steam's ability to log in properly.

  • Open the Steam app.
  • Go to Steam > Settings.
  • Select the Downloads section on the left.
  • Scroll down to the Clear Download cache section.
  • Click Clear Cache.
  • Next, go to the In Game section on the left.
  • Under Delete web browser data, click on Delete.

Fix 5. Disable antivirus or firewall temporarily

Your security software might be blocking Steam from accessing the internet.

  • Disable your antivirus software from its main dashboard, usually accessible via the system tray icon.
  • In Windows search, type firewall. Select Windows Defender Firewall.
  • Click on Turn Windows Defender Firewall on or off.
  • Select Turn off Windows Defender Firewall for both private and public network settings. Remember to turn these back on after testing.

Fix 6. Flush DNS

Flushing the DNS cache can resolve network-related issues that prevent Steam from connecting.

  • Type cmd in Windows search.
  • Right-click on Command Prompt result and pick Run as administrator.
  • When the User Account Control window shows up, click Yes.
  • In the new window, copy and paste the following commands, pressing Enter each time:
    ipconfig /flushdns
    ipconfig /registerdns
    ipconfig /release
    ipconfig /renew
    netsh winsock reset
  • Reboot your device to implement the changes.

Fix 7. Synchronize time and date

Ensure that your computer's time is set correctly.

  • Type in Control Panel in Windows search and press Enter.
  • Go to Clock and Region and click on Date and Time.
  • Pick the Internet Time tab and select Change Settings.
  • Make sure that the Synchronize with an Internet time server box is ticked.
  • Click Update now and OK.

Fix 8. Reinstall Steam

Reinstalling Steam can resolve issues caused by corrupted installation files.

  • Type Control Panel in Windows search and press Enter.
  • Go to Programs > Uninstall a program.
  • Find Steam in the list and select Uninstall.
  • Follow the prompts to remove Steam from your system.
  • After uninstallation, restart your computer.
  • Download the latest version of Steam from the official website.
  • Run the installer and follow the instructions to install Steam.
